fg-taxon #98 (Calodexia sp.) 1

This is a really interesting group of species – all very similar in general body shape and with a curious ovipositor that appears to emerge vertically, under the abdomen.

EDIT (Monty Wood 26/9/2010): These are all Calodexia spp. – parasitoids of cockroaches. Monty recalls seeing army ants driving invertebrates ahead of them and Calodexia swarming and leaping on cockroaches as they emerge from cover.

One comment on "fg-taxon #98 (Calodexia sp.)

